The core temperature pill, also known as an ingestible thermometer, is a small capsule that contains sensors capable of measuring the body’s internal temperature. Once ingested, the pill travels through the digestive system and eventually reaches the intestines, where it begins to transmit data wirelessly to an external device.

One of the key advantages of the core temperature pill is its ability to track core body temperature, which is the temperature of the body’s vital organs and tissues. This is in contrast to surface temperature measurements taken with external devices, which may not always accurately reflect the body’s true internal temperature. Monitoring core temperature is crucial for detecting and managing conditions such as fever, heat stroke, hypothermia, and other temperature-related illnesses.
The core temperature pill is particularly beneficial for athletes and individuals participating in strenuous physical activities. By monitoring core temperature in real-time, athletes can optimize their performance, prevent overheating or dehydration, and reduce the risk of heat-related injuries. Coaches and trainers can use the data provided by the pill to make informed decisions about training intensity, hydration strategies, and recovery protocols.
Another important application of the core temperature pill is in medical settings, where it can play a vital role in patient care and monitoring. For example, healthcare providers can use the pill to continuously monitor the temperature of critically ill patients, ensuring timely intervention in case of fever or other temperature abnormalities. The pill can also be used to monitor the effectiveness of treatments, such as fever-reducing medications or cooling therapies.
